The Landscape of IELTS in Mainland China
In Mainland China, the IELTS assessment is administered through a collaboration in between the British Council and the National Education Examinations Authority (NEEA), under the Ministry of Education. This partnership ensures that the testing environment throughout dozens of cities— from Beijing and Shanghai to inland hubs like Chengdu and Xi'an— satisfies global standards of integrity.
Prospects in China have 2 primary formats offered to them: the conventional Paper-based test and the significantly popular Computer-delivered IELTS. Both formats result in the very same worldwide recognized “Test Report Form” (TRF).

Security Features of an Authentic Test Report Form (TRF)
An authentic IELTS certificate contains numerous sophisticated security features designed to prevent forgery. Acknowledging these features is essential for candidates to ensure they have actually received the main document and for institutions to confirm its authenticity.
- The Hologram: A high-security 3D hologram is embedded on the bottom right of the TRF.
- The Test Report Form Number: A distinct 15— 18 character code located at the bottom right of the certificate. This code is the main key for electronic confirmation.
- Recognition Stamps: The form consists of an official stamp from the British Council or the particular test center.
- Security Background: The paper itself includes complex “micro-printing” and watermarks that are challenging to duplicate with basic printing innovation.
- Prospect Photograph: A high-resolution photo taken on the day of the test is printed straight onto the type to avoid identity alternative.
- * *
The Verification Process: How Authenticity is Checked
In the digital age, a physical certificate is typically simply the primary step. The majority of universities, companies, and government companies (Recognizing Organizations or ROs) do not rely entirely on the paper document. Instead, they use the IELTS TRF Verification Service.
This online website permits authorized organizations to get in the TRF number found on a prospect's certificate. If the certificate is genuine, the website will show the coordinating results, photograph, and prospect information straight from the IELTS database. If the details do not match or the TRF number is invalid, the certificate is instantly determined as deceitful.
Actions Institutions Take to Verify Results
- Accessing the Portal: The RO logs into the protected IELTS Verification site.
- Information Entry: The RO gets in the TRF number offered by the applicant.
- Validation: The system recovers the score straight from the central database.
Secondary Audit: For visa applications, authorities like the UK Home Office or the Australian Department of Home Affairs have direct data-sharing arrangements with IELTS.

The Proliferation of Scams and the “Buy Without Exam” Myth
Despite the rigorous security steps, there is a consistent market in China for “ensured” or “genuine” IELTS certificates offered without the need for an evaluation. These services frequently run through encrypted messaging apps and social media, promising “inside connections” at the British Council or NEEA.
It is clinically and administratively impossible for a third-party representative to insert a deceptive rating into the main IELTS database. Any certificate bought through these ways is, by meaning, a forgery.
Red Flags of Fraudulent Services
- Surefire Scores: Promises of a “Band 7.0 or 8.0” despite English capability.
- No Test Required: Claims that the candidate does not require to sit for the examination.
- High Upfront Costs: Demanding countless RMB for a “signed up” certificate.
Non-Official Websites: Directing prospects to fake confirmation websites that imitate the main IELTS or NEEA websites.
- *
Repercussions of Using Non-Authentic Certificates
The charges for attempting to utilize a phony IELTS certificate in China are severe and typically long-term. Beyond the instant loss of cash paid to fraudsters, prospects deal with long-lasting consequences:
- Permanent Bans: Candidates captured with fraudulent documents are typically banned from taking the IELTS test for 2 years or longer.
- Visa Refusals: Immigration authorities (such as those in Canada, the UK, and Australia) take file fraud very seriously. A phony certificate can cause a 10-year restriction or a long-term “Persona Non Grata” status because country.
- University Expulsion: If a university finds a student used a phony certificate after admission, the trainee is generally expelled instantly, surrendering all tuition costs paid.
Legal Action: In some jurisdictions, providing created files to government agencies can cause criminal charges.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)
1. Can I get an IELTS certificate in China without taking the examination?
No. Any service claiming to supply a “signed up” or “authentic” certificate without an exam is a scam. IELTS scores require biometric confirmation (image and finger scan) on the day of the test.
2. The number of copies of the initial TRF can I get?
Prospects are issued one personal copy. However, the British Council can send up to 5 extra copies straight to Recognizing Organizations (universities, etc) free of charge if requested throughout registration.
3. What should I do if my TRF is lost or harmed?
Prospects in Mainland China need to contact the NEEA IELTS National Call Center. While duplicate copies are normally not sent out to the candidate, the center can help in sending main electronic or paper copies to pertinent institutions.
4. For how long is a genuine IELTS certificate valid?
An IELTS certificate stands for 2 years from the date of the test. After 2 years, ball game expires and can no longer be verified through the official website.
5. Can I confirm my own TRF online?
Candidates can view their outcomes on the main NEEA site utilizing their login credentials. Nevertheless, the complete “Verification Service” is reserved for organizations to ensure privacy and security.
6. Does the “IELTS for UKVI” certificate look various?
The security features are mostly the exact same, however the “IELTS for UKVI” (UK Visas and Immigration) TRF will define that it was taken at a SELT (Secure English Language Test) center authorized by the UK Home Office.
